It sounds like you've exceeded your skill level by killing solo queue players too quickly without getting a handle on the basics of playing Killer first, so your MMR has now increased to a point where you're unprepared for Survivors with experience. That can happen with a Killer like Kaneki that makes it easy to coast to early victories through brute force with little understanding of the fundamentals.

My advice is three-fold: spend more time practicing against good opponents to learn counters, spend time playing KIllers other than Kaneki so you're forced to rely less on his power carrying you and have to learn how to deal with loops, and spend time playing as Survivor to learn their patterns and weaknesses.

You should also specifically avoid perks like No One Escapes Death, a common newbie trap, which can inflate your early kill rate and rapidly increase the difficulty of matches. Savor the time when you are facing easier opponents and focus on chases and fundamentals rather than blowout wins.

End of day, flashlight squads are mildly annoying but you shouldn't be losing to them often. People going for flashlight saves are not doing gens, where the real threat lies.

Diminishing Returns feels like it unnecessarily punishes gimmick builds, rather than meta perk interactions. by lostneverlanddreamer in deadbydaylight

[–]OliveGuardian99 4 points5 points  (0 children)

The thing about Diminishing Returns is they already existed. Using +Heal Speed bonus as an example, stacking Botany Knowledge and Empathic Connection always caused you to lose around 2 seconds of healing efficiency you'd have gotten running the perks alone.

LIVE:
Empathic Connection - saves 4.1 seconds on a heal

Botany Knowledge = saves 5.3 seconds on a heal

Empathic + Botany together = saves 7.4 seconds on a heal (not 9.4 you'd get if you could just add the two individual bonuses together, a penalty of 2 seconds due to diminishing returns)

PTB:
Empathic Connection - saves 4.1 seconds on a heal (same as live)

Botany Knowledge = saves 5.3 seconds on a heal (same as live)

Empathic + Botany together = saves 6.4 seconds on a heal, down from 7.4 on live. A pretty massive loss of efficiency of 3 seconds, enough for me to no longer run these two perks together.

What would I run instead? A meta perk, almost none of which are affected by diminish returns. Or else a gen rush perk because not much else makes sense.

BHVR to half of all build synergies after the update: by Kim-K-Kitsuragi in deadbydaylight

[–]OliveGuardian99 7 points8 points  (0 children)

The source of so called 2-second heals isn't "heal bonuses." It's Resurgence, which bypasses the healing bonus system completely and awards heal 70% heal *progress.* That means a 16 second heal is reduced by 70%--true reduction, not charge rate completion. A single slot dedicated to Resurgence reduces the time it takes to heal from 16 seconds to 4.8 seconds. That's before factoring in any healing bonuses, if the unhooker has We'll Make It (again, 1 single perk) the heal time is in fact your dreaded number: 2.4 seconds.

On live it takes an entire build to hit 4.8 heal speed with healing speed bonuses.

This change will in fact probably motivate to swap my Botany + Empathic Connection build which is now being double penalized (once by the diminishing returns penalty that has ALWAYs existed on healing perks and once again by BHVRs new misguided system) over to Resurgence and We'll Make It but if you're thinking the game's about to get easier for Killers you're in for rude awakening. Especially when it finally hits you that the penalties slowing this heal bonus also apply to Killer heal speed debuffs, so good luck slowing heals down.

Diminishing returns healing tested by Smooth_Resource_6500 in deadbydaylight

[–]OliveGuardian99 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Even before this change Healing Speed suffered from Diminishing Returns so running them together carried a penalty.

For example, on live Empathic Connection by itself shaves off 4.1 seconds from a heal and Botany Knowledge shaves off 5.3 seconds. If you added this together you might think 4.1 + 5.3 = 9.4 seconds, but run together they actually shave off 7.4 seconds, which is 2 seconds of efficiency loss.

What BHVR has done is penalized healing and other charge bonuses twice. You're taxed by their new modifier system, and then taxed again by charge rate penalty.

All of this adding up to: just run meta perks like Resurgence to still heal at crazy speeds, bypass stacking bonuses whenever possible, especially in mid-tier perks like Empathic Connection, Leader, or Better than New.
